Working Principle:
The X9315UMZ-2.7T1C7964 utilizes a resistor ladder network controlled by digital inputs to adjust the resistance value. It consists of a series of resistive elements connected between the device's terminals, with wiper contacts that tap onto the resistive ladder at different points. By changing the digital input code, the wiper position shifts along the ladder, effectively changing the output resistance.
Core Technology Features:
- Digital Control: The device features digital control inputs that enable precise and repeatable resistance adjustments, ensuring reliable performance in various applications.
- Non-volatile Memory: The X9315UMZ-2.7T1C7964 integrates non-volatile memory, allowing it to retain its resistance settings even when power is removed. This feature is advantageous in applications requiring persistent settings or parameter storage.
- Low Power Consumption: With a low supply voltage requirement of 2.7 volts and efficient power management, the device minimizes power consumption, making it suitable for battery-powered and low-power applications.
- Small Form Factor: The integrated circuit is designed in a compact form factor, saving board space and enabling integration into space-constrained designs.
Application Scenarios:
In audio equipment, the X9315UMZ-2.7T1C7964 can be used for volume control, allowing users to adjust audio levels precisely. By interfacing the DCP with a microcontroller or user interface, volume adjustments can be made digitally, providing a convenient and accurate user experience.
In lighting systems, the device can serve as a dimmer control, enabling smooth and gradual adjustments to the brightness levels of LEDs or incandescent bulbs. This digital control capability enhances user comfort and energy efficiency in lighting applications.
In instrumentation and test equipment, the X9315UMZ-2.7T1C7964 can be utilized for calibration and offset adjustment, ensuring accurate measurements and calibration settings. Its non-volatile memory feature preserves calibration data, simplifying system maintenance and calibration procedures.
